ATTRITORS AND BALL MILLS HOW THEY WORK Robert …

which enables us to see how the Attritor fits into the family of mills. For example, ball mills use large media, normally 1/2" or larger, and run at a low (10-50) rpm. The other mills, such as sand, bead, and horizontal, use smaller media from 0.3mm to 2mm, but run at a very high rpm (roughly 800-1200).

What Are the Differences between Dry and Wet Type Ball Mill?

The water can wash away the fine particles in time to avoid over-grinding. The wet ball mill has a low noise, and low environmental pollution. The wet ball mill has a simple transportation device with less auxiliary equipment, so the investment is about 5%-10% lower than that of a dry ball mill. The grinding particle size is fine and uniform.

Evolution of grinding energy and particle size during dry ball …

Fig. 1 a shows the oscillatory ball mill (Retsch® MM400) used in this study and a scheme (Fig. 1 b) representing one of its two 50 mL milling jars. Each jar is initially filled with a mass M of raw material and a single 25 mm-diameter steel ball. The jars vibrate horizontally at a frequency chosen between 3 and 30 Hz. Ball Mill Maintenance & Installation Procedure

Ball Mill Sole Plate. This crown should be between .002″ and . 003″, per foot of length of sole plate. For example, if the sole plate is about 8′ long, the crown should be between .016″ and .024″. Ball Mill Sole Plate. After all shimming is completed, the sole plate and bases should be grouted in position.
